Inbar, Dan E. – Studies in Educational Evaluation, 1981
Although Israel's educational system is centralized, the syllabi of the Department of Curriculum Planning (part of the Ministry of Education) are not compulsory. Curriculum facilitators are used as the link between the Department of Curriculum Planning and the teachers in the school where the facilitator continues to teach. (RL)

Goldhammer, Keith – Journal of Teacher Education, 1981
To achieve excellence in teacher education and in its professional contributions, teacher education must become knowledge-oriented. It must also be highly evaluative, adapt to the needs of different groups, and be relevant to the problems of teaching and learning. (JN)

Stanton, H. E. – Australian Journal of Education, 1979
A rationale for the use of student evaluations of courses and teachers and the functions such feedback can fulfill are outlined. The importance of an educational consultant, working with the lecturer to interpret and use student-generated data, is stressed. A case study embodying these elements is presented. (Editor/SJL)
